The league phase draw for the 2024–25 UEFA Europa League took place at the Grimaldi Forum in Monaco on 30 August 2024, 13:00 CEST. [ 11 ] [ 12 ] The 36 teams were divided into four pots of nine teams each based on their UEFA club coefficient .

The 2024–25 UEFA Europa League knockout phase began on 13 February with the knockout phase play-offs and will end on 21 May 2025 with the final at the San Mamés Stadium in Bilbao, Spain, to decide the champions of the 2024–25 UEFA Europa League. [1]
The last champions before the UEFA Cup was renamed to UEFA Europa League were Shakhtar Donetsk, who beat Werder Bremen 2–1 after extra time in the 2009 final. [5] Benfica and Marseille have lost the most finals, with three losses in the competition. The current champions are Atalanta, who defeated Bayer Leverkusen 3–0 in the 2024 final.
Formerly, the reigning champions qualified for the Europa League to defend their title, but since 2015 they qualify for the Champions League. The 2023–24 UEFA Europa League knockout phase began on 15 February with the knockout round play-offs and ended on 22 May 2024 with the final at the Aviva Stadium in Dublin, Republic of Ireland, to decide the champions of the 2023–24 UEFA Europa League. [1] A total of 24 teams competed in the knockout phase. [2]
